Where to stay in Scarborough

Find the best Scarborough areas and neighborhoods for the activities you enjoy most.

Downtown Toronto

Dive into the bustling Entertainment District with its lively restaurants, nightclubs, and live theatre, or explore the upscale Yorkville area, boasting designer boutiques and world-class galleries. Don't miss the iconic Royal Ontario Museum and the revitalized Harbourfront area.

North York

Home to interactive museums like Ontario Science Centre and Aga Khan Museum, North York offers ample shopping at Yorkdale Shopping Centre and Fairview Mall. Easily accessible via TTC subway and bus lines.

Toronto Entertainment District

Downtown Toronto's vibrant hub features theatres, performing arts centres, and Toronto Blue Jays games, with numerous bars and restaurants catering to diverse crowds. Don't miss the iconic CN Tower!

Etobicoke

Suburban and industrialized, Etobicoke boasts numerous parks like James Gardens and Centennial Park, as well as golf courses such as St. George's Golf and Country Club. Enjoy convenient public transportation via TTC and GO stations.

Old Toronto

Boasting a high population density, this area is home to multiple post-secondary institutions like Toronto Metropolitan University and OCAD University. Enjoy the vibrant academic atmosphere and easy access to renowned hospitals.

Best time to go to Scarborough

The best time to visit Scarborough can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Scarborough fal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Scarborough falls in January and February. February has average visitor numbers and mostly cloudy weather.

How can I get around Scarborough and the greater Toronto area?
If you want to see more of the city, Scarborough Centre Station is the closest metro stop. Others nearby include McCowan Station and Midland Station. If you want to see some sights out of town, hop on a train. Agincourt Station is the closet train station, but Eglinton Station and Kennedy GO Station are also close by.
